Taiwan scrap prices soften amid downtrend
Taiwanese imported scrap prices continue to trend down, but domestic purchasing prices have held level this week.
Kallanish assessed HMS 1&2 80:20 container scrap on Wednesday at $430/tonne cfr Taiwan, down by $10/t from last week.
